In this study, ultrasound-assisted alkaline pretreatment is developed to evaluate the morphological and structural changes that occur during pretreatment of cellulose, and its effect on glucose production via enzymatic hydrolysis. The pretreated samples were characterized using scanning electron microscopy, infrared spectroscopy, and X-ray diffraction to understand the change in surface morphology, crystallinity and the fraction of cellulose Iβ and cellulose II. The combined pretreatment led to a great disruption of cellulose particles along with the formation of large pores and partial fibrillation. The effects of ultrasound irradiation time (2, 4 h), NaOH concentration (1–10 wt%), initial particle size (20–180 μm) and initial degree of polymerization (DP) of cellulose on structural changes and glucose yields were evaluated. The alkaline ultrasonic pretreatment resulted in a significant decrease in particle size of cellulose, besides significantly reducing the treatment time and NaOH concentration required to achieve a low crystallinity of cellulose. More than 2.5 times improvement in glucose yield was observed with 10 wt% NaOH and 4 h of sonication, compared to untreated samples. The glucose yields increased with increase in initial particle size of cellulose, while DP had no effect on glucose yields. The glucose yields exhibited an increasing tendency with increase in cellulose II fraction as a result of combined pretreatment.  相似文献

A series of N‐substituted maleimide derivatives have been developed via acetic acid‐mediated microwave reaction pathway, which was identified as the incomparable method for this maleimide compounds. All the synthesized compounds were tested for antioxidant activity by DPPH and H2O2 methods. Compounds 5h and 5m were displayed with higher antioxidant activity in two methods. The structure–activity relationship demonstrated that the compounds having electron releasing substitutions 5h and 5m generally show beneficial activity than electron capture substitution cores. Thus, compounds 5h and 5m may be useful as an exogenous antioxidant.  相似文献

A problem of mixed convection on a horizontal plate is reconsidered assuming that the plate is subjected to a variable temperature or variable heat flux. The plate is considered permeable allowing blowing or suction of the fluid. The results of free and forced convection are obtained as special cases of this study of mixed convection. It is also shown that the results corresponding to prescribed temperature are related to those of prescribed surface heat flux by simple conversion formulae.

Natural fiber-reinforced nanocomposites were prepared by incorporating wild cane grass fiber and organically modified montmorillonite (MMT) nanoclay into polyester resin. The composites were formulated up to a maximum volume of fiber of approximately 40% and their mechanical properties were investigated. The mean tensile strength and tensile modulus of nanoclay-filled wild cane grass fiber composites are 6.3% and 18.3% greater than those of wild cane grass fiber composites, respectively, without addition of nanoclay at maximum percentage volume of fiber. The mean flexural strength of nanocomposites at maximum percentage volume of fiber was increased to a maximum of 221 Mpa and flexural modulus to 4.2 Gpa. The mean impact strength of nanoclay-filled wild cane grass fiber composites was increased to 376.7 J/m at maximum percentage volume of fiber. The weight loss of nanoclay-filled wild cane grass fiber/polyester composites was 30% and 22% less than that of composites without nanoclay at maximum percentage volume of fiber. The results indicated that the use of nanoclay showed significant improvement in all the mechanical properties of wild cane grass fiber-reinforced composites.  相似文献

An epimerization free and efficient total synthesis of immunosuppressant cyclosporin O (CsO) by step-by-step assembly of amino acids in solution phase is reported. The couplings were performed by employing Fmoc-amino acid chlorides and were mediated by zinc dust under neutral conditions. The yield and purity of the coupling of sterically hindered N-methylamino acids to N-methylamino acids at positions 8, 9, 10, and 11 were enhanced by repeating the coupling thrice at these particular junctures. All the 10 intermediate peptides pertaining to CsO and the final CsO were isolated and completely characterized through IR, 1H NMR, mass spectrometry, and HPLC techniques.  相似文献

Raman spectra and fluorescence of BaTiO3 and silica microspheres of different sizes have been studied. The observed whispering gallery modes (WGMs) have been assigned using theoretical simulations based on the Lorenz–Mie theory. The WGMs are found to have selective enhancements in the Raman spectra. The variations in the Raman spectra with the radial position of the excitation spot and excitation wavelength have been correlated with the morphology‐dependent internal field distributions of the microspheres. The effect of a thin dye coating on the fluorescence and Raman spectra was studied, and a coating thickness of ∼200 nm was estimated from the theoretical simulation of experimentally observed data based on the Aden and Kerker theory. Summary A theoretical investigation of inertia effects on the load capacity of an externally pressurized bearing with an electrically conducting lubricant is presented. It is shown that there is a negative contribution to the load capacity of the bearing by inertia forces. In the presence of an axial magnetic field the absolute value of the load due to inertia forces decreases when the strength of the field increases while in the presence of an axial current, the load due to inertia forces is independent of axial current. At large values of axial magnetic fields and axial currents, it is shown that the inertia forces can be neglected. A numerical example is considered to study the relative importance of inertia and viscous terms.  相似文献

Facile and selective synthesis of 3-aryl/alkylamino 5-aryl/alkyl 1,2,4-oxadiazoles starting from N-acylthioureas has been demonstrated. The regio-selectivity is achieved by simply selecting an appropriate base used for the generation of hydroxyl amine from the corresponding hydrochloride salt. This method also avoids the use of toxic cyanogen bromide. The structure of the synthesized oxadiazoles has been resolved by tandem mass spectral studies.  相似文献
